Abstract
The hydrodynamic stability of a thermodiffusive iInterface in a near-supercritical
fluid is studied. The Navier-Stokes equations written for a van der Waals gas
above its critical point are solved by means of a finite volume numerical
method. The growth rate of the fluctuations shows that there exists a cutoff
wave number beyond which the short wavelengths are stabilized by diffusion.
The good agreement between the obtained values and recent theories for miscible
fluids confirms that a near-critical fluid subjected to a thermal gradient may
develop a gravitational instability for which the density gradient is driven by
thermal diffusion and large compressibility
